| Explain Berkline Manual Recline? So I've seen mentioned in a few posts that the manual recline option isn't that great. I can't even see a lever in the photos on the UHE web site; so could you explain how you execute a manual recline and why the three choices aren't so great? The recliners I currently have are more of a manual release and then you use your body to position the amount of recline along the entire length. But it seems the Berkline manual recline only allows three set positions? | |||

| Re: Explain Berkline Manual Recline? I know that in the past, they had it more as you describe - using your weight to control it. The seats I currently have are the same way - and I'd never by them like this again. Realistically, there are places where it's more uncomfortable trying to keep the recline right and it's IMO distracting. I think this is why Berk went that way. They had a lot of complaints about the same thing. Now, take this with a grain of salt as I've not sat in any of the manual Berks for over 4 years now. I'm only speaking to personal experience in the past. Bryan | |||

| Re: Explain Berkline Manual Recline? Josuah, The manual recliner control is a push button, which is located on the right side of the seating cushion and that is why you cannot see it. YOu need to slide your hand in between a cushion and the armrest (or another seating cushion depending on your configuration) and push the button there.
